Question:

Which among the following pairs of 'animal - phylum of animal kingdom they belong' is incorrect?

Options:

Liver fluke - Nematoda

Sycon - Porifera

Prawns - Arthropoda

Starfish - Echinodermata

Correct Answer:

Liver fluke - Nematoda

Explanation:

The correct answer is Option (1)- Liver fluke - Nematoda

The incorrect pair among the animals and their corresponding phyla is:

  • Liver fluke - Nematoda (Incorrect)

Here's the breakdown:

  • Liver fluke: Liver flukes belong to the phylum Platyhelminthes. They are flatworms known for being parasitic.
  • Sycon (correct): Sycon is a type of sponge, which belongs to the phylum Porifera. Sponges are multicellular organisms with simple body structures.
  • Prawns (correct): Prawns are crustaceans and belong to the phylum Arthropoda. Arthropods are the largest animal phylum with jointed legs and an external skeleton.
  • Starfish (correct): Starfish are echinoderms and belong to the phylum Echinodermata. Echinoderms have radial symmetry and a spiny outer skeleton.
